--- Begin Message ---Package: cereal Version: 0.24-1 Severity: wishlist Hi, when I have a session for /dev/ttyUSB0 defined, cereal won't let me create a second one ('/dev/ttyUSB0' is already being monitored by session 'other-session-name'). I can think of two trivial situations where this may be desired: (1) I am using the same port to connect to different hosts that need different settings, for example a different baud rate (2) I am moving the same host between places where the same port is being used for device A1 in location A and for device B1 in location B. In both situations, it is desireable to have both sessions always defined (for example, to keep log files around), and that's fine as long as only one session is started at a given time. Please consider giving cereal-admin create a --force switch which will switch of the "is already being monitored" check for such situations. Doing the check by default is fine for the majority of cases, but it should be possible to disable it if one knows what one does. I am currently forced to go through the stop-destroy-create-start routine way too often instead of just being able to do stop-start. Greetings Marc
